Chemical & Physical Properties
[ Density]:
1.275g/cm3
[ Melting Point ]:
215-217ºC(lit.)
[ Molecular Formula ]:
C7H10ClN3O
[ Molecular Weight ]:
187.62700
[ Exact Mass ]:
187.05100
[ PSA ]:
67.15000
[ LogP ]:
2.64800
[ Water Solubility ]:
alcohol: freely soluble
